Planning Your Essay

Before you start writing your essay, it is essential to plan it out. Planning is the most crucial step in the essay writing process as it helps you organise your thoughts and ideas, ensuring that your essay is coherent and structured. Here are some tips on how to plan your essay effectively:

  1. Understand the Essay Question: Before you start planning your essay, make sure you understand the essay question. Read the question carefully and identify the key points you need to address in your essay.

  2. Brainstorm Ideas: Once you understand the essay question, brainstorm ideas related to the topic. Write down all your ideas, no matter how big or small.

  3. Create an Outline: Use your brainstormed ideas to create an outline for your essay. Your outline should include the introduction, body paragraphs, and conclusion.

  4. Conduct Research: Once you have an outline for your essay, conduct research to find supporting evidence for your arguments. Use reputable sources such as academic journals, books, and articles.

Writing Your Essay

Once you have completed the planning stage, it's time to start writing your essay. Follow these tips to ensure your essay is clear, concise, and well-structured:

  1. Write a Strong Introduction: Your introduction should be engaging and informative. It should introduce the topic, provide background information, and state your thesis.

  2. Develop Your Arguments: Use your outline to develop your arguments in the body paragraphs. Each paragraph should have a clear topic sentence and provide supporting evidence.

  3. Use Proper Grammar and Punctuation: Your essay should be free of grammatical errors and punctuation mistakes. Use a spell checker to catch any errors.

  4. Stay on Topic: Make sure you stay on topic throughout your essay. Each paragraph should relate back to your thesis.

Editing Your Essay

The final stage of essay writing is editing. Editing is essential to ensure that your essay is error-free and well-polished. Here are some tips on how to edit your essay effectively:

  1. Review Your Essay: Before you start editing your essay, read through it several times to get a sense of the overall flow and structure.

  2. Check for Grammar and Spelling Errors: Use a spell checker to catch any grammar and spelling errors. Make sure you check for commonly misspelt words such as "their" and "there."

  3. Revise Your Sentences: Make sure your sentences are clear and concise. Avoid using long, complicated sentences that are difficult to read.

  4. Get Feedback: Ask a friend, family member, or teacher to review your essay and provide feedback. They may be able to spot errors or suggest improvements you haven't considered.
